Małgorzata Adamkiewicz is a Polish billionaire businesswoman and philanthropist. She is a medical doctor and has a PhD in endocrinology.
She is the co-owner and President of the supervisory board of the pharmaceutical company Adamed Pharma, [1] the Founder of the Adamed Foundation, and the Vice Chair of the Polish Business Roundtable .
For over two decades, Forbes has ranked her as one of the leading Polish business leaders. [2] [3]
She graduated with a medical degree from the Medical University of Warsaw, specializing in internal medicine and endocrinology. [4] She worked in the Endocrinology Clinic of the Medical Postgraduate Training Centre at the Bielanski Hospital in Warsaw. [5] During that time, in 2000, she completed a PhD in endocrinology ("Coronary Artherosclerosis and Androgens Concentration in Men"). [6]
Since 1986, she has been involved in the operations of Adamed, the pharmaceutical company started by her father-in-law Marian Adamkiewicz. [4] [7] In 2000, she and her husband, Maciej Adamkiewicz, assumed control of the company, with Małgorzata becoming the General Director. [3] Over the next two decades, she expanded the company significantly, making Adamed one of the largest family companies in Poland according to Forbes. [8]
Since 2015, she has been the Vice Chair of the Polish Business Roundtable , [9] Poland's leading business organization originated by Zbigniew Brzezinski. She served on the University Council of the Medical University of Warsaw, [9] [10] was a member of the Business Chapter at Jagiellonian University and the Endocrine Society, [4] and sat on the supervisory board of Poland's second-largest bank, PEKAO S.A. In 2014, she founded the Adamed Foundation, which supports high-achieving high school students interested in STEM. She serves as the foundation's chairperson. [9]
In 2013, President of Poland Bronislaw Komorowski awarded her the Gold Cross of Merit. [9] [12] [13]
In 2019, she was awarded the Medal of the Centenary of Regained Independence (pol. Medal 100-lecia Odzyskania Niepodległości). [14]
